UDF Independent MLA Mani C Kappan has voiced his dissatisfaction with the proposed Cabinet allocation in Kerala, suggesting that all members of 'Team UDF' should be accommodated. He revealed that he was offered a ministerial berth for 2.5 years, after which another leader would take his place, a proposal he did not agree to.

In a stunning electoral victory, the ruling Communist Party if India (Marxist)-led Left Democratic Front (LDF), rode back to power in Kerala winning 99 of the 140 seats, bucking the over four decade long trend of Communists and Congress-led United Democratic Front coming to power alternatively.
